site stats

Cpp deque iterator

http://www.java2s.com/Tutorial/Cpp/0440__deque/0120__deque-iterator.htm WebIf you want to iterate a subrange of a container using a range-based for loop, you can use the std::ranges::subrange function. This function is available in the C++20 standard library and creates a subrange from an existing range by specifying the beginning and end iterators. Ahh! r/cpp has verified that ChatGPT did not hallucinate once again!

CPP Deque - W3schools

WebJul 26,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. WebImplemented template class Deque, an analogue of the STL class with amortized running time O(1). The internal type iterator is also implemented. Push and pop operations does … the cheeky cherub belfast https://artisanflare.com

deque Class Microsoft Learn

WebErases elements from a deque and copies a new set of elements to the target deque. C++ Copy template void assign( InputIterator First, InputIterator Last); void assign( size_type Count, const Type& Val); void assign(initializer_list IList); Parameters First WebMar 17, 2024 · An iterator is invalidated only when the corresponding element is deleted. std::list meets the requirements of Container, AllocatorAwareContainer, SequenceContainer and ReversibleContainer . Template parameters Member types Member functions Non-member functions Deduction guides (since C++17) Example Run this code WebCreate C++ STL Deque. In order to create a deque in C++, we first need to include the deque header file. #include . Once we import this file, we can create a deque … tax court guilty until proven innocent

deque Class Microsoft Learn

Category:C++ Deque - Programiz

Tags:Cpp deque iterator

Cpp deque iterator

deque - cplusplus.com

WebApr 6, 2024 · stack和queue都采用deque容器作为默认的适配器,我们stack,queue也可以使用vector,list作为适配器. 【总结】. 1.stack是一种容器适配器,专门用在具有后进先出操作的上下文环境中,其删除只能从容器的一端进行元素的插入与提取操作. 2.stack是作为容器适配器被实现的 ... WebLocation. 494 Booth Rd, Warner Robins GA 31088. Call Directions. (478) 322-0060. 1109 S Park St Ste 203, Carrollton GA 30117. Call Directions. (678) 796-0511. 147 Commerce …

Cpp deque iterator

Did you know?

WebEven if you do not end up with a fully working program, make sure to attempt each of the eight operations. Iterate through the commands string and conditionally do the following for each character in order: 1 = Pop the queue. 2 = Pop the front of the deque. 3 = Pop the back of the deque. 4 = Pop the stack. 5 = COPY the top of the stack into the ... WebThere are such ways to output it. The first: deque::iterator It; for ( It = My_Deque.begin (); It != My_Deque.end (); It++ ) cout << *It << " "; The second: for …

WebLinear in deque::size (destructors). Iterator validity All iterators, pointers and references are invalidated. Data races The container and all its elements are modified. Exception … WebCodeforces-Problems-Solutions / 276B_Little_Girl_and_Game.cpp Go to file Go to file T; Go to line L; Copy path ... #include #include #include using namespace std; using namespace chrono; void solve_array(); ... (first_iterator, last_iterator, x) – Returns an iterator to the first occurrence of x in vector and points ...

Web【 덱(Deque) 이란? 】 C++ STL에서 제공하는 덱(Deque)은 Double Ended Queue의 줄임말로, 양쪽 끝에서 삽입과 삭제가 가능한 선형 자료구조이다. 즉 큐와 스택의 기능을 모두 갖추었는데, 특히 큐와 스택이 데이터의 접근이 제한적이라는 한계점을 … Web【 덱(Deque) 이란? 】 C++ STL에서 제공하는 덱(Deque)은 Double Ended Queue의 줄임말로, 양쪽 끝에서 삽입과 삭제가 가능한 선형 자료구조이다. 즉 큐와 스택의 기능을 …

WebDeque destructor (public member function) operator= Assign content (public member function) Iterators: begin Return iterator to beginning (public member function) end …

WebAug 16, 2024 · C++ Iterator library std::iterator is the base class provided to simplify definitions of the required types for iterators. Template parameters Member types … tax court method for vacation homeWebSep 14, 2024 · Said differently, the elements to remove are in the range defined by the iterator returned by std::remove and the end of the collection. Therefore, to effectively remove values from a vector, deque … tax court method rentalWeb18 rows · Jan 31, 2024 · The time complexities for doing various operations on deques … tax court filing fee waiverWebApr 12, 2024 · deque容器的迭代器也是支持随机访问的 deque容器的构造函数 #include using namespace std; #include //deque构造函数 void printDeque(const deque& d) { for (deque< int >::const_iterator it = d. begin (); it != d. end (); it++) { cout << *it << " "; } cout << endl; } void test01() { deque< int >d; for ( int i = … the cheeky girlsWebApr 13, 2024 · Functions: cl::opt< bool > EnzymePrintActivity ("enzyme-print-activity", cl::init(false), cl::Hidden, cl::desc("Print activity analysis algorithm")): cl::opt< bool ... the cheeky kimWebUsing the Front of a Deque: 22.6.4. Use iterator and reverse_iterator with deque: 22.6.5. Print the contents in reverse order using reverse_iterator and functions rbegin() and … the cheeky fellowWebNov 11, 2024 · std::deque:: push_front C++ Containers library std::deque Prepends the given element value to the beginning of the container. All iterators, including the end () iterator, are invalidated. No references are invalidated. Parameters value - the value of the element to prepend Return value (none) Complexity Constant. Exceptions the cheeky girls gabriela irimia